We'll be staying at Aulani after Thanksgiving and I have a couple questions about parking. We are not DVC members and will be renting a car for our whole stay. Does the $35 per day include valet or is that for self parking? Do they charge you when you check in or at checkout? If it is valet, do you tip every time you pick up AND drop off? I've never valet parked. Thanks for any help you can give me, it's little things like this that worry me! ;)
 
It looks $35 per day is either one Here is what the Aulani website says.

PARKING FOR DAYTIME VISITORS
Valet parking is $35 per day; Self parking is $10 for the first hour and $5 for every half hour after that, with a maximum day rate of $35.* When you spend $35* or more at Aulani dining venues or at Laniwai Spa during a single visit, you'll get validated valet or self parking for up to 4 hours.

PARKING FOR OVERNIGHT GUESTS
There's so much to do at and around Aulani that you may not need a car! For overnight Guests who wish to park, self parking is $35 per day*—or for the same price, enjoy convenient valet parking service. Plus, Disney Vacation Club Members enjoy complimentary parking for up to 2 vehicles.

BTW, while at Aulani last month, we were told that complimentary DVC parking is only if you are staying at the resort on points. It sounds like members have come by to take a look see and wanted to park for free.

I will be staying the first week of November using rented points. From my research, it seems that I will not have to pay for parking because we are using points for the stay (even if they aren't our points). I will be sure to report back on my experience in a few weeks.
 
It's free parking if you are staying on DVC points. It not, it's $35 a day. Now IF you spend $35 or more in a restaurant on property, it's free parking. My wife and I are DVC, we eat there when we are not staying and get our parking validated

I have the OP's question about valet tipping. How often and how much?
 
usually one or 2 bucks when you pick up the car is normal.

Not to appear like a complete dunce, but my understanding is that when we first arrive a valet will quickly descend upon us and take the car. Do I give him a couple bucks? I want to have the correct amount of bills ready.

When the valets "descend" you can just simply let them know that you are DVC and will be self parking after you get checked in. They usually just direct you then where to pull off to the side and leave your car till you complete check in (at least that has been our experience both time we have arrived). That way you dont have to worry about them requiring a tip at that time.
